About the job

As a full-time Department Manager, you will lead and support your team, fostering an inclusive culture that promotes collaboration and an entrepreneurial spirit. Your impact will be felt through the outstanding customer experiences you help create, as well as the growth and success of both your team and the company. The team thrives on collaboration and shared insights, making every day an exciting opportunity to connect with customers and drive success.

You'll be responsible for

👥

Leading the team

Leading your team to deliver an outstanding customer experience by ensuring excellent operational and visual standards, while actively promoting and selling our products.
📈

Analyzing performance

Taking responsibility for your store and department’s strengths, analyzing sales performance, identifying commercial opportunities, setting goals, and creating plans to optimize results, profits, and stock levels.
🌱

Recruiting and developing

Recruiting, onboarding, and developing your team while fostering an inclusive and collaborative culture that promotes growth and innovation.
